What Is Niacinamide and How Does It Work in Acne Treatment
Niacinamide serum is the water-soluble form of vitamin B3 that your skin actually uses to regulate oil production, calm inflammation, and rebuild protective barriers. When I first started researching active ingredients for OMMA's patch formulations, niacinamide kept appearing in clinical literature as one of the few ingredients that addresses multiple acne triggers simultaneously without stripping or irritating skin.
The science is simple: niacinamide works by reducing excess sebum production at the cellular level. Your sebaceous glands respond to this vitamin by producing less oil without shutting down completely, which is why you won't get the tight, flaky side effects common with stronger acne treatments. At therapeutic concentrations, niacinamide delivers measurable results while maintaining skin tolerance even for sensitive types.
What makes niacinamide particularly valuable for post-acne repair is how it inhibits melanosome transfer to keratinocytes. Translation: it stops the pigment-producing cells from dumping excess melanin into surrounding skin cells after a breakout heals. This mechanism explains why niacinamide fades those stubborn dark spots faster than many prescription alternatives in dermatological trials, without the photosensitivity risks.
The molecule penetrates through the stratum corneum and regulates cytokine production in deeper skin layers. This matters because acne isn't just a surface problem, inflammation starts beneath the skin where your immune system overreacts to clogged pores. Niacinamide directly targets this inflammatory cascade, preventing comedones from progressing into angry, painful papules and pustules.

Can niacinamide patches fade acne scars?
Niacinamide patches effectively fade post-inflammatory hyperpigmentation (those flat dark spots left after breakouts heal), but they won't fill in depressed atrophic scars or smooth raised hypertrophic scars. The melanin-regulating properties of niacinamide work on discoloration, not texture changes. For actual scar tissue, you'd need professional interventions like laser resurfacing or microneedling treatments, different from the dissolving microdarts in at-home patches.
What percentage of niacinamide is most effective in patches?
Clinical research consistently shows that 2-5% niacinamide concentrations deliver optimal results without irritation. Higher percentages don't necessarily work better, your skin can only absorb so much at once, and excessive concentrations can trigger flushing in some people.
